Coffee Description
Vayichil is a decaffeinated coffee grown by 65 women smallholder farmers in the region of Jaltenango, Mexico. These farmers are part of La Tribu, a local producer organization which is made up of over 300 families. Vayichil means "to dream" in Tzotzil, a local language spoken by many Mayan communities throughout Chiapas.
Vayichil is decaffeinated using the Mountain Water Process in Santa Cruz, a method that helps preserve the coffee's complexity while highlighting its naturally sweet, smooth character. It’s a decaf you can enjoy at any hour — without sacrificing flavor, traceability, or values.
